    Default Backlink from Forbes, BBC CNN, Nytimes, Guardian, HuffingtonPost

    Hi guys, I am working with a guy who can get a back link on some high profile sites like Forbes, BBC CNN, NY times, Guardian, HuffingtonPost etc. What they do is find old articles with deadlinks in and then 301's the domain to your site.

    You cant choose the anchor or site which is 301'd but it is a easy/cheap way to get a link from one of these sites. I am not saying this is perfect or the holy grail of a link but it is a easy way to get one, if you need/want one.

    Obviously the link could be from an irrelevant anchor/site and the whole back link portfolio from the old domain would also get 301'd to your site.

    No.......there are links on these sites going to old expired domains so these are found and then 301d to your domain. The links on these sites are not touched.

    Eg a link on bbc going to xyz site which has expired. Buying the xyz site and then 301 the domain to your domain.
